The Hardy Boys is a mystery drama television series, based on The Hardy Boys book series created by Edward Stratemeyer. The show is produced by Nelvana and Lambur Productions.[1] The first season was released on Hulu on December 4, 2020,[2][3] and the second season was released on April 6, 2022.[4] The series has been renewed for a third and final season on July 26, 2023.[5][6]
The series stars Alexander Elliot, Rohan Campbell, Keana Lyn, Riley O'Donnell, Bea Santos, and Adam Swain as the main characters. Filming took place mainly in Ontario, Canada, with featured locations including Cambridge, Port Hope, and Hamilton.[7]
The Hardy Boys follows two brothers, Frank and Joe Hardy, alongside their friends and father, trying to disclose the truth about something quite menacing happening right in their own town of Bridgeport.
The series was announced in September 2019, and slated to be released on streaming service provider Hulu the next year. At the same time, Jason Stone and Steve Cochrane were set as part of the show's development.[11][12] The Hardy Boys is based on the fictional book series of the same name written by multiple authors. A trailer was released in November 2020.[13] The first season of The Hardy Boys premiered on Hulu in the United States on December 4, 2020, and consisted of 13 episodes. It began airing weekly on March 5, 2021 on YTV in Canada.[14] The Hardy Boys was filmed in Ontario, Canada, with Cambridge serving as a featured location,[7][15] and other settings including Port Hope and Hamilton.[16][15] Almost the entirety of the cast were announced at once upon the series' December 4 release.[17]
